1 /*
2 * A driver for the AverMedia MR 800 USB FM radio. This device plugs
3 * into both the USB and an analog audio input, so this thing
4 * only deals with initialization and frequency setting, the
5 * audio data has to be handled by a sound driver.

24 /*
25 * Big thanks to authors and contributors of dsbr100.c and radio-si470x.c
26 *
27 * When work was looked pretty good, i discover this:
28 * http://av-usbradio.sourceforge.net/index.php
29 * http://sourceforge.net/projects/av-usbradio/
30 * Latest release of theirs project was in 2005.
31 * Probably, this driver could be improved through using their
32 * achievements (specifications given).
33 * Also, Faidon Liambotis <paravoid@debian.org> wrote nice driver for this radio
34 * in 2007. He allowed to use his driver to improve current mr800 radio driver.
35 * http://kerneltrap.org/mailarchive/linux-usb-devel/2007/10/11/342492
36 *
37 * Version 0.01: First working version.
38 * It's required to blacklist AverMedia USB Radio
39 * in usbhid/hid-quirks.c
40 * Version 0.10: A lot of cleanups and fixes: unpluging the device,
41 * few mutex locks were added, codinstyle issues, etc.
42 * Added stereo support. Thanks to
43 * Douglas Schilling Landgraf <dougsland@gmail.com> and
44 * David Ellingsworth <david@identd.dyndns.org>
45 * for discussion, help and support.
46 * Version 0.11: Converted to v4l2_device.
47 *
48 * Many things to do:
49 * - Correct power management of device (suspend & resume)
50 * - Add code for scanning and smooth tuning
51 * - Add code for sensitivity value
52 * - Correct mistakes
53 * - In Japan another FREQ_MIN and FREQ_MAX
54 */

172 /* switch on/off the radio. Send 8 bytes to device */
173 static int amradio_set_mute(struct amradio_device *radio, char argument)
174 {
175 int retval;
176 int size;
177
178 radio->buffer[0] = 0x00;
179 radio->buffer[1] = 0x55;
180 radio->buffer[2] = 0xaa;
181 radio->buffer[3] = 0x00;
182 radio->buffer[4] = AMRADIO_SET_MUTE;
183 radio->buffer[5] = argument;
184 radio->buffer[6] = 0x00;
185 radio->buffer[7] = 0x00;
186
187 retval = usb_bulk_msg(radio->usbdev, usb_sndintpipe(radio->usbdev, 2),
188 (void *) (radio->buffer), BUFFER_LENGTH, &size, USB_TIMEOUT);
189
190 if (retval < 0 || size != BUFFER_LENGTH) {
191 amradio_dev_warn(&radio->videodev.dev, "set mute failed\n");
192 return retval;
193 }
194
195 radio->muted = argument;
196
197 return retval;
198 }
199
200 /* set a frequency, freq is defined by v4l's TUNER_LOW, i.e. 1/16th kHz */
201 static int amradio_setfreq(struct amradio_device *radio, int freq)
202 {
203 int retval;
204 int size;
205 unsigned short freq_send = 0x10 + (freq >> 3) / 25;
206
207 radio->buffer[0] = 0x00;
208 radio->buffer[1] = 0x55;
209 radio->buffer[2] = 0xaa;
210 radio->buffer[3] = 0x03;
211 radio->buffer[4] = AMRADIO_SET_FREQ;
212 radio->buffer[5] = 0x00;
213 radio->buffer[6] = 0x00;
214 radio->buffer[7] = 0x08;
215
216 retval = usb_bulk_msg(radio->usbdev, usb_sndintpipe(radio->usbdev, 2),
217 (void *) (radio->buffer), BUFFER_LENGTH, &size, USB_TIMEOUT);
218
219 if (retval < 0 || size != BUFFER_LENGTH)
220 goto out_err;
221
222 /* frequency is calculated from freq_send and placed in first 2 bytes */
223 radio->buffer[0] = (freq_send >> 8) & 0xff;
224 radio->buffer[1] = freq_send & 0xff;
225 radio->buffer[2] = 0x01;
226 radio->buffer[3] = 0x00;
227 radio->buffer[4] = 0x00;
228 /* 5 and 6 bytes of buffer already = 0x00 */
229 radio->buffer[7] = 0x00;
230
231 retval = usb_bulk_msg(radio->usbdev, usb_sndintpipe(radio->usbdev, 2),
232 (void *) (radio->buffer), BUFFER_LENGTH, &size, USB_TIMEOUT);
233
234 if (retval < 0 || size != BUFFER_LENGTH)
235 goto out_err;
236
237 radio->curfreq = freq;
238 goto out;
239
240 out_err:
241 amradio_dev_warn(&radio->videodev.dev, "set frequency failed\n");
242 out:
243 return retval;
244 }
